Output ab359849112fa2c9b1c2cce17fd2096dac07f481263a561e6a5e178ecc50d4c4:24

value
634763800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d967fa0843af89ddcceac766c1e89d6ebbfc7532 OP_EQUAL
address
ACForShbQQQPW8cmyKGqyVMEmZnkvkQVrs
transaction
ab359849112fa2c9b1c2cce17fd2096dac07f481263a561e6a5e178ecc50d4c4